Intrigue about Mukesh's absence at key event at home

Actor and MLA Mukesh’s absence during the Communist Party of India state conference in Kollam has created sensation. 
Despite the event being held in his constituency, the popular actor and legislator was notably absent from the event, with reports indicating he was not even present in Kollam. Instead, Mukesh is believed to be out of the district, adding fuel to speculations surrounding his participation in the ongoing party activities.
This marks a significant departure from the usual practice, as Mukesh has been an active participant in party events in the past. The timing of his absence is particularly noteworthy, as the CPM state conference is a major event within the party's calendar, with several key discussions and decisions typically taking place at such conferences.
Sources have revealed that Mukesh, who hails from Aluva, has not attended party activities following a recent legal development. This stems from a case involving a complaint filed by a female actor, which led to the submission of a charge sheet against him. Although the actor has denied any wrongdoing, the case has put him at the centre of controversy, making his absence from party functions even more conspicuous.
While Mukesh did attend the logo unveiling event for the conference earlier, it was the only party-related activity he participated in. The reason for his non-participation in the rest of the conference remains unclear, but sources close to the actor suggest there may be an informal ban on his involvement in the ongoing party proceedings. Some suggest that his absence could be linked to the case, with party leaders preferring to keep a low profile on the matter in public.
The actor’s absence has raised questions within party circles, with many speculating that it may be linked to the legal case, which has sparked significant media attention.
